Coingecko Reviews

11 Best Crypto APIs for Developers
CoinGecko’s mission is to empower crypto users and help them gain a better understanding of fundamental factors that drive the market. In addition to crypto prices, trading volume, and market capitalization, CoinGecko also measures community growth, open-source code development, events and on-chain metrics for a complete analysis beyond just technical indicators.
